Coated cermet GT9530 for long tool life ISO CCMT rhombic insert, size 06 0.8 mm corner radius for fine finishing With cylindrical hole + one-sided countersink Consistent finishes and longer tool life through GT9530 technology The grade supplied, GT9530, is a coated cermet formulated to combine low wear with excellent surface integrity in stable turning conditions. Cermet combines ceramic and metallic binders to give a harder cutting edge than standard carbide, which results in improved surface finish and reduced flank wear during finishing passes. In practical terms, this means fewer reworks and longer periods between insert changes, supporting higher throughput and lower per-part tooling cost. The controlled toughness of the grade helps avoid premature chipping in steady, well-fixtured setups. Why indexable inserts are indispensable in modern machining
Indexable inserts, also known as cutting inserts or indexable cutting inserts, are standardised, replaceable cutting elements that mount on tool holders such as turning bits, milling cutters or drills. Made from wear-resistant materials like carbide, cermet, ceramic or other superhard grades, they carry the actual cutting edge and allow a worn corner to be rotated or flipped instead of replacing or regrinding the entire tool body.
How these inserts work and when to choose them
In everyday workshop and production settings, indexable inserts perform the direct material removal on the workpiece. Standard inserts for tool systems without internal coolant typically feature closed faces or a single central fixing hole, with heat evacuation handled by external machine nozzles. Inserts designed for systems with internal coolant are engineered to support coolant flow: they include calculated chipbreaker geometries that guide an internal coolant jet under the chip or, in specialised designs, contain sintered microchannels to direct coolant right to the cutting edge. Such coolant-compatible inserts are essential for machining heat-resistant alloys, heavy cutting operations and deep internal machining, where thermal load and chip control are critical.
Tangible benefits for production and workshop efficiency
Choosing the right indexable inserts delivers measurable operational advantages:
- Reduced downtime: faster changeover because a worn insert is simply indexed rather than the whole tool being replaced.
- Extended cutting-edge life: targeted coolant application and optimised chipbreaker design lower thermal stress and improve tool life.
- Consistent part quality: predictable cutting-edge geometry from standardised inserts maintains tolerances across batches.
- Versatility: availability in carbide, cermet, ceramic and superhard grades permits selection according to workpiece material and cutting conditions.
- Lower tooling costs over time: fewer full-tool replacements and less regrinding required.

What materials are indexable inserts available in?
Indexable inserts are available in wear-resistant grades such as carbide, cermet, ceramic and other superhard materials, selected according to the workpiece material and cutting conditions.
When should I choose inserts with internal coolant support?
Choose inserts designed for internal coolant when machining heat-resistant alloys, performing heavy cuts or working in deep internal features, because the coolant reduces thermal load at the cutting edge and actively improves chip breakage.
How do chipbreaker geometries affect performance?
Chipbreaker geometries on indexable inserts guide the chip flow and, when matched to an internal coolant jet, direct the coolant under the chip to control temperature and facilitate reliable chip formation, which extends edge life and stabilises machining.
Can standard inserts be used with external coolant only?
Yes; standard inserts for tool systems without internal coolant typically have closed faces or a central fixing hole and rely on external machine nozzles for heat evacuation, which is sufficient for many routine, accessible cuts.
